Seeing a bald eagle, depending on your personal and cultural background, can be interpreted in a few different ways:

  • National Symbolism: In the United States, the <a href="https://www.wikiwhat.page/kavramlar/bald%20eagle%20symbolism">bald eagle symbolism</a> is deeply ingrained as a symbol of freedom, strength, courage, and independence. Seeing one can evoke feelings of patriotism and national pride.

  • Good Luck/Positive Sign: For some, a bald eagle sighting is simply considered a sign of <a href="https://www.wikiwhat.page/kavramlar/good%20luck%20signs">good luck signs</a>, positive energy, or a blessing. It might be interpreted as encouragement during a challenging time.

  • Spiritual Significance: In some Native American cultures, <a href="https://www.wikiwhat.page/kavramlar/bald%20eagle%20spiritual%20meaning">bald eagle spiritual meaning</a> is highly valued. The eagle can represent a connection to the Creator, heightened intuition, spiritual vision, or the ability to soar above challenges. It's often seen as a messenger from the spirit world.

  • Natural Wonder: For many, the <a href="https://www.wikiwhat.page/kavramlar/natural%20world%20admiration">natural world admiration</a> of a bald eagle is simply a majestic sight. Given its size, power, and grace, spotting one in the wild can be a humbling and awe-inspiring experience.

  • Environmental Indicator: Bald eagles were once endangered, and their resurgence is a testament to conservation efforts. Seeing one can symbolize the success of <a href="https://www.wikiwhat.page/kavramlar/conservation%20efforts%20success">conservation efforts success</a> and the health of the ecosystem.
